Calculate Log Base 365 of 239

To solve the equation log 365 (239)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 239, a = 365:
    log 365 (239) = log(239) / log(365)
  3. Evaluate the term:
    log(239) / log(365)
    = 1.39794000867204 / 1.92427928606188
    = 0.92823031041483
    = Logarithm of 239 with base 365
